Railroad Ephemera and Advertising - Day 1
Our Thursday session is filled with a selection of vintage paper, some china, lanterns, ticket dater, keys, passes, and more.
The core of the paper comes from a western Illinois based collection which highlights the Chicago & Alton and other railroad in the St. Louis area. The Chicago & Alton paper and passes in this sale are really special and include a handful of pieces rarely seen for sale. This collection was not only limited to the Midwest, he collected late 1800’s and early 1900’s timetables and passes from around the United States which are included in this sale.
Another paper highlight in this session includes the collection of one of the heads of maintenance of way for the Pennsylvania Railroad out of Fort Wayne, Indiana. During his time he collected a number of interesting Pennsylvania items including freight car, passenger, and locomotive diagrams, original Pennsylvania service structure blue prints, track charts, and more. There are also a number of operational books for maintenance of way machines such as the Jordan Spreader, Burro Crane, and more.
Along with these two groups of paper we will have a selection of lanterns, cap badges, baggage tags, keys, and locks.
Highlights of the Thursday sale include a 1904 Colorado Midland color timetable, 1902 Chicago and Alton “Fencing Girl†advertising calendar, a group of pre Civil War Chicago and Rock Island stock certificates, a set of original architectural plans for the Toledo, Ohio passenger station from the Pennsylvania Railroad (Dated 1879 and 1902), and a St. Louis Public Service Company destination roll.
